Overview

Gigasheet is a cloud spreadsheet designed to open and analyze files with millions or billions of rows that would crash Excel or Google Sheets, with no database setup required. It includes AI-powered column enrichment, natural-language filtering, and automated data cleaning. Security and log analysis teams use it to process large event files directly in a browser.
